About the Role

Monday - Friday 7AM-5PM

We are seeking a reliable and hard‑working Site Operative to support the day‑to‑day operation and ensure work is carried out safely and efficiently. You'll play a key role in supporting site activities and maintaining high standards of safety.

Roles and Responsibilities
  • Sorting, bulking and preparing waste for offsite disposal. For example, baling of plastic waste, bulking of paint tins, bulking of aerosols, sorting of non‑hazardous wastes for landfill
  • Ensuring all waste is stored safely in designated areas
  • Offloading/loading vehicles with forklift
  • Assisting drivers with loading/unloading vehicles
  • Informing technical team when loads need to be booked out of site/skips exchanged
  • Fulfil orders in a timely and efficient manner
  • Look after related plant and equipment
  • Accepting deliveries
  • General housekeeping on site
  • Follow systems of work in place for your safety
  • Take care to make sure your activities do not put others at risk
  • Any other reasonable request
Skills and Experience
  • Experience of working within a similar environment would be beneficial
  • Full UK driving licence – essential
  • FLT licence – desirable
